View attachment 8624 We all get cancellations here and there but does anyone ask why?

Part of me wants to know why but then the other part doesn't.

Had one cancel last week and above is the screen shot.

By the tone of the message and the content I assumed either unhappy with the service or maybe undercut.

As it turns out the house is for sale. I don't know why they couldn't just say that in the email!

Speaking as a canvasser - the last month or so has been tough. Not sure why but I think it's a combination of good weather and end of school holidays. Good weather means the windows aren't showing the dirt and end of school holidays means spent out over summer and expenses in kitting out the kiddies.

At least, that's what I'm hoping is the reason. (Otherwise, I'm f*cked!).
